Note N46
Smoked a pipe.
From Charles Max Heinrich's probate record in 1963, "Louie Hofer is presently actively engaged in farming and has continuously engaged in appraising farm land in Bureau, Putnam and Marshall Countries, for more than Thirty (30) years, last past, and personally and well acquainted with the value of farm land."
According to Lee Hofer, Louie spoke German with his mother and had been taught it at St. Mary's School in Henry. Lee also mentions that various people had told him that Louie helped needy families to get food during the Depression.
1940 Census: Louie was the person who answered the enumerator's question. He owned his own home which was listed as having a value of 1800 dollars, the most valuable home in the immediate area. He reported that his highest grade of school completed was eighth. He lived in the same house had been living in in 1935.
"Deaths
Louis Hofer, Sr.
HENRY -- Funeral services for Louis Hofer Sr., 74, retired Henry farmer, will be held at 10:30 a.m. tomorrow in St. Mary's Roman Catholic Church, Henry, the Rev. William Feeney officiating.
Friends may call at the Ries Mortuary from 3 to 5 and 7 to 9 p.m. tomorrow where the Rosary will be recited at 8. Burial will be in Calvary Cemetery.
Mr. Hofer died at 8 a.m. yesterday in St. Margaret's Hospital at Spring Valley.
Born March 11, 1895 at Henry, the son of Charles and Laura Heinrich Hofer, he was married to Alta Rinehart at Peoria June 12, 1919, and she survives.
Also surviving are three sons, Leland, Harold, and Louis K. Hofer, all of Henry; two daughters, Mrs. John Monier, of Henry; Mrs. Peter McCallister [sic] of Chillicothe; one brother, Charles Hofer of Peoria; one sister, Mrs. V.M. Kaliher of Henry; and 17 grandchildren. He was preceded in death by one son and one grandchild.
Mr. Hofer was a member of St. Mary's Church, the Knights of Columbus, the Marshall-Putnam Fair Association and of Amrican [sic] Legion, having been a veteran of World War I."
-Peoria Journal Star, Thurs., Jan 15, 1970, A4
Louis E. Hofer was the only grandson of Engelbert Hofer to have male children who had male children.
According to Alta (Rinehart) Hofer, Louie suffered particular bad bout of rheumatism during their first year of marriage.
